Output 50e548628d4e61613f24bcaff8666652fdd3dfaebd4f6dec45343a7d6b2441cb:0

value
12129688
script pubkey
OP_HASH160 OP_PUSHBYTES_20 64685812879ec4926d16ae86c36e9f81f721c565 OP_EQUAL
address
MH44oZedBKvYB1SiDY5GG1tHVZjiPJCJsL
transaction
50e548628d4e61613f24bcaff8666652fdd3dfaebd4f6dec45343a7d6b2441cb
spent
true